SlipstreamOS Posted March 27, 2006 Posted March 27, 2006 During the initial XP install, it requests four files that are not present on the CD. The file names are unimportant, as my question is how do I remove them from the install sequence so that I dont have to replace them and get that garbage on my computer? If I created dummy files in their places, would that circumvent the need to press ESC every time it encounters a missing file error? Is there a list somewhere that I can edit their names out of?I appologize if this post has already been answered, but I can't think of the correct keywords to find them on my own.

Djé Posted March 28, 2006 Posted March 28, 2006 Have a look in dosnet.inf and txtsetup.sif in your I386 folder. Although the list is not exclusive and none of this is simple to deal with.You may also want to read thoroughly some posts on RyanVM's forum do understand what these files do...Anyway, good luck and thanks for all the fish.
